Issuing a New Card in Enhanced User Management Environment

Note: See Credentials Parameters for more details on how to enable the Enhanced User Management environment.

1 - From the Users  toolbar, select the Card  button. The displayed Card window is used to enter/verify general information on the cardholder.

2 - Click the New  button (first button) in the toolbar. The Card user name  field is enabled to enter the card holder’s name. You can enter up to 50 characters.

3 - Click Save .

4 - Double-click on the Card type field to open the Card type window. Select the card type for the new card. The card type is used to group cardholders; it is useful for modifying an existing card group and creating reports, etc. For more information on how to create/modify card types, see Card Type Definition.

Note:  In the Card type field, you can right-click the Card type field and choose New to create a new card type, choose Select to select an existing card type or you can choose Edit to edit an existing card type.

5 - Click on the Card number  tab, double-click on Card #1 if you want to change the label.

6 - Enter the Card number .

•   If EntraPass was previously configured for Multiple Card Format , you can modify the card format by right-clicking the Card number  field, see Defining a Card Display Format  to enable the multiple card formats and select a new default card format for Card #1 to Card #5 . The default card format is HH:DDDDD (Hexadecimal and decimal 24 bits).

Note: The Access Level will apply to the user which means all 5 cards.

•   When the Multiple Card Format  is enabled: A list of all card formats will be displayed when you right-click in the card number field.

•   When a card format has been defined by the system administrator, the card format has a check mark next to its description.

7 - As an option, you can assign the Card number  immediately. If you are using the EntraPass Web, you can leave the field empty and assign the card number at a later time.

8 - If your access rights allow it, you can decide to Display card number  or not, then the user card number in reports and message lists in the EntraPass workstation s .

Note: The system automatically displays the Creation date,  the Modification date  and the Modification count information on the upper right-hand side of the Card dialog.

9 - Check the Use expiration date option and select the corresponding date.

10 - Check the Trace  option if you want to monitor the use of a particular card. Selecting this option will cause the “Card traced” event to be generated each time this card is presented to a card reader. For example, you can request and generate a report containing the “card traced” event in order to verify user actions.

11 - Check the Stolen/Lost  option, if the card has been stolen or lost. The card will not be functional anymore.

12 - Repeat Steps 5 to 11 for Card #2 to Card #5, if applicable. The selections can be different for the 5 cards.
